I built this yesterday, finished painting today... a 5 piece drum practice pad, the snare will be my real snare with a silencer... its a 6 piece :D made of 1 1/4 pvc, 5/8 ply wood, rubber matting, the one they use as flooring on some jeepneys. if anyone knows where I can find good gum rubber sheets, I'd appreciate it. the "tom" pads can be removed I dunno for what reason but they can be, :D
pics: testing how it would look, the pads are 10" diameter btw. (http://i90.photobucket.com/albums/k280/g0d5_g1ft/08202010007.jpg)
bass pad added, and tom "mounts" added to pads (http://i90.photobucket.com/albums/k280/g0d5_g1ft/08202010008.jpg)
finished painting, taken just 15 minutes ago: (http://i90.photobucket.com/albums/k280/g0d5_g1ft/08212010009.jpg)
at first I thought pvc wouldn't hold but, to my surprise its holding well, saved me more than 1.5k than using steel pipes :D
over all cost, roughly 1.5k
